# :cookie: Chocolate Whoopie Pies with Vanilla Buttercream Filling
|
||||
|
||||

|
||||
|
||||
| :fork_and_knife_with_plate: Serves | :timer_clock: Total Time |
|
||||
|:----------------------------------:|:-----------------------: |
|
||||
| 16 | 15 minutes |
|
||||
|
||||
## :salt: Ingredients - Cookies
|
||||
|
||||
- :ear_of_rice: 1.75 cup all-purpose flour
|
||||
- :salt: 0.5 tsp salt
|
||||
- :chocolate_bar: 0.75 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
|
||||
- :cup_with_straw: 1.5 tsp baking soda
|
||||
- :dash: 0.5 tsp baking powder
|
||||
- :butter: 0.5 cup butter
|
||||
- :candy: 1 cup sugar
|
||||
- :egg: 1 large egg
|
||||
- :glass_of_milk: 1 cup [buttermilk][1]
|
||||
- :icecream: 1 tsp vanilla
|
||||
|
||||
## :salt: Ingredients - Filling
|
||||
|
||||
- :butter: 0.5 cup butter
|
||||
- :candy: 4 cup confectioners' sugar
|
||||
- :glass_of_milk: 0.25 cup milk
|
||||
- :icecream: 0.5 tsp vanilla
|
||||
|
||||
## :cooking: Cookware
|
||||
|
||||
- 1 baking pans
|
||||
- 1 parchment paper
|
||||
- 1 electric mixer
|
||||
- 1 1-ounce ice cream scoop
|
||||
- 1 disposable pastry bag
|
||||
|
||||
## :pencil: Instructions - Cookies
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 1
|
||||
|
||||
Preheat oven to 400°F. Sift together all-purpose flour, salt, unsweetened cocoa powder, baking soda, and baking powder.
|
||||
Set aside. Line 2 baking pans with parchment paper. In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ment,
|
||||
c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add egg, [buttermilk][1], and vanilla. Beat until well combined. Slowly
|
||||
add dry ingredients. Mix until combined.
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 2
|
||||
|
||||
Using a 1-ounce ice cream scoop, place dough onto a parchment-lined baking pan, 12 per pan. Bake for 10 to 12 minutes.
|
||||
Remove to a rack to cool. Repeat with remaining batter.
|
||||
|
||||
## :pencil: Instructions - Filling
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 3
|
||||
|
||||
In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, cream butter until smooth and creamy, 2 to 3
|
||||
minutes. With mixer on low speed, add 3 cups confectioners' sugar, milk, and vanilla; mix until light and fluffy. If
|
||||
necessary, gradually add remaining cup sugar to reach desired consistency.
|
||||
|
||||
### Step 4
|
||||
|
||||
Transfer buttercream to a disposable pastry bag and snip the end. When cookies have cooled completely, pipe 2
|
||||
tablespoons buttercream onto the flat side of half the cookies. Sandwich with remaining cookies, pressing down slightly
|
||||
so that the filling spreads to the edge of the cookies.
